All Collections
Integration guides
Automate your data with Zapier
Automate your data with Zapier

Register attendees or send Contrast data to your favorite tools

Luuk de Jonge avatar
Written by Luuk de Jonge
Updated over a week ago

Nobody has time to export and then import data. That's why there's the Contrast Zapier integration. Click here to find our app on Zapier.

Send your data from Contrast to all of your favorite tools. Not sure what we mean by that? Imagine adding all people that registered to your webinar to Mailchimp, or perhaps only add the people that viewed your webinar to your CRM.

What's Zapier?

Zapier is a product that allows end users to integrate the web applications they use and automate workflows.

Click here to learn more about Zapier

What you need to get started

  • Well obviously an account on Contrast πŸ˜‰

    • Zapier will require a password, so if you've used SSO (Google, Microsoft) to create an account, you can create a password using this link

  • And a Zapier account

    • There's a free plan for Zapier, which includes 100 tasks per month

How to create your Zap

Go to Zapier and log in. Now click on Create Zap and search for Contrast.

Choosing your event type

Now select the type of event you want to send. This event will start the automation. For more info regarding the different event types, check out the final bits of this article. Click now on continue.

Choose your Contrast account

You now need to give Zapier access to your Contrast account. Log in to your Contrast account. If you don't have a password because you used SSO to create your account, then request a password through this link.

Click continue and send a test event. Zapier will now tell you if everything is working and if not, what to do to troubleshoot it.

Selecting an action

Now that you've created your trigger event, it's time to select the action you want to be performed whenever your event triggers.

Use the search bar to find your favorite app. For every app the setup will be different. Here's what a successful test with Slack looks like for example:

If you need help setting things up, don't hesitate to shoot us a message. We're happy to help.

πŸ’‘Pro tip: use the same event multiple times

You can use the same event multiple times. This will save you a lot of time setting things up. Here's an example of what we do.


Types of events you can send

A registration is not the same as having watched the webinar. And having watched it live, is not the same as having watched the replay. Right? That's what we think as well. So we decided to split these up:

  1. People that registered to one of your webinars

  2. People that watched a webinar live

  3. People that watched the replay of a webinar

It's up to you to decide which events are relevant for you to send to your tools.

Registrations

This type of event is triggered when somebody registers to any of your webinars. This is the information that we send:

Field

Description

id

Attendee unique ID of the

email

Attendee email address

firstName

Attendee first name

lastName

Attendee last name

Company

Company name given upon registration

jobTitle

Job title given upon registration

phoneNumber

Phone number given upon registration

industry

Industry given upon registration

websiteUrl

Website given upon registration

webinarName

Webinar name the attendee registered for

groupName

Channel which the webinar belongs to

organizationName

Organization which the group belongs to

registeredAt

Date time when the attendee registered

utmCampaign

UTM campaign used on the landing page

utmSource

UTM source used on the landing page

utmMedium

UTM medium used on the landing page

utmTerm

UTM term used on the landing page

utmContent

UTM content used on the landing page

Viewed live

Triggered when the person watches your webinar while its live.

Field

Description

id

Attendee unique ID of the

email

Attendee email address

firstName

Attendee first name

lastName

Attendee last name

webinarName

Webinar name the attendee registered for

groupName

Channel which the webinar belongs to

organizationName

Organization which the group belongs to

viewedAt

Date time when the watched the live

Watched replay

As the name suggests, triggered when somebody watches a replay of your content.

Field

Description

id

Attendee unique ID of the

email

Attendee email address

firstName

Attendee first name

lastName

Attendee last name

webinarName

Webinar name the attendee registered for

groupName

Channel which the webinar belongs to

organizationName

Organization which the group belongs to

viewedAt

Date time when the watched the replay

Did this answer your question?